"Seven angels having the seven plagues"

Text: Revelation 15:6

SEVEN GOLDEN BOWLS

A vision was given for John to see. Seven mighty angels came from the temple of God in heaven. They were given seven bowls which were full of the wrath of God.

“After these things I looked, and behold,
the temple of the tabernacle of the testimony in heaven was opened.
And out of the temple came the seven angels having the seven plagues,
clothed in pure bright linen,
and having their chests girded with golden bands.
Then one of the four living creatures gave to the seven angels
seven golden bowls full of the wrath of God
who lives forever and ever.
The temple was filled with smoke
from the glory of God and from His power,
and no one was able to enter the temple
till the seven plagues of the seven angels were completed.”
Revelation 15:5-8

1. The temple in heaven.

a) It was called “The temple of the tabernacle of the testimony”.

b) It was called the Tabernacle before the Temple was built in Jerusalem.

c) The Tabernacle housed the Testimony which is a reference to the Ark.

d) In the Ark the Testimony were the Scriptures.

2. The servants of God in the heavenly Temple.

a) They were angels.

b) Seven of them were featured.

c) They stood in the presence of God.

d) Their clothing:

i) They wore pure bright linen.

ii) They wore golden bands around their chests.

iii) Their clothing reflected the majesty and glory of God.

3. The four living creatures.

a) They were even higher ranking angels.

b) One of them gave to the Seven Angels Seven bowls of wrath.

c) These were flat bowls that could be easily poured out.

4. The glory of God.

a) It filled the heavenly Temple.

b) The glory of God was manifested.

i) It was compared to smoke.

ii) The “smoke” is like the cloud of glory that came upon the Tabernacle after Moses consecrated it (Exodus 40:34-35).

c) No one was able to enter the Heavenly Temple at this juncture.

d) Such was the unmatched glory of God manifested.
